May 2025 - Apr 2026Dock Road area has the 2nd lowest crime rate of 51 local areas in Grays Thurrock , and the 15th lowest crime rate of 501 local areas in Thurrock .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Dock Road (RM17 6EX) in the last 12 months was 8.0 per 1,000 residents and was 90.2% lower than the Grays Thurrock average (81.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 2 offences recorded.
